Description
An old-school challenge in a crisp and colorful package, Wizardry: Labyrinth of Lost Souls revitalizes the time-honored formula of the original dungeon crawler series with modernized visuals and sound.

Choose each of your six team members’ class, race, gender, and moral alignment, then delve into one of several dungeons near the central town hub. Advance with caution — monsters are vicious, deadly, and attack in packs. Plan each expedition carefully, stay focused on your objectives, and know when to retreat to the surface.

In between expeditions, chat with the locals, pick up new quests, pray for guidance at the temple, go bargain-hunting for new/rare equipment, and more. With patience, skill, and careful planning, your party will rise from a gang of paupers to a mighty force.
The magic torches are lit, the monsters are ravenous, and the kingdom is waiting for a new hero. Enter the world of Wizardry: Labyrinth of Lost Souls and experience a classic adventure reborn.

KEY FEATURES

Your Party, Your Way
Choose from eight classes and five races to build a six-person team with diverse but complimentary skill sets. Change their classes in mid-adventure to fit your needs, or focus on leveling up their primary class to earn bonus skills for the party’s benefit.

So Beautiful and So Dangerous
Tangle with a menagerie of over 100 distinctive monsters, from the traditional to the bizarre, all drawn by famed series illustrator Jun Suemi. The game also features character illustrations by renowned commercial artist Yuki Hayabusa.

Conquer the Dungeons
Every step through the underworld is fraught with danger, and one wrong move can end your adventure. But if you have the grit to withstand what the dungeons throw at you, both you and your party will gain enough experience to stroll through them like you own them.

Wizardry’s Rebirth on PC
The PC remaster of this classic originally released for PlayStation 3 features English and Japanese text with the original Japanese voiceovers, high-resolution graphics, and a brand new Turbo Mode to make exploring the game’s massive dungeons a breeze. All story DLC is included, and players can download the Growth Fruit DLC for free to give themselves a boost when creating characters.

Great Throwback Wizardry Title

I'm a big fan of the NES Wizardry games (the two released in North America) and Wizardry V for the SNES. I recently bought a repro cart of Wizardry: Throb of the Demon's Heart for the SNES, but the ROM is super glitchy. I had avoided Labyrinth of Lost Souls because of the low ratings, but the more I read, it seemed like some gamers had a problem with the old school Wizardry formula vs. the execution of the game itself. That's fair. However, if you like the old school dungeons crawlers, this game is an incredible experience. Break out the graph paper! (Actually, the in-game mapping is pretty good, so you may not need to). Besides sticking true to the older Wizardry style of gameplay, the UX is well-done—smooth, intuitive, and easy to navigate. Visually, it's a nice visual upgrade and I much prefer the anime-style graphics vs. the traditional Wizardry artwork of "trying to make the game developers look like heroes". I have played through Wizardry 8 and Tales of the Forsaken Land, and I much prefer the game style of Labyrinth of Lost Souls. I like the straightforward battles (Wizardry 8 could have some tedious encounters) and the confined but familiar pace of older dungeon crawlers. I'm surprised it took me so long to finally play this one. While it's not for everyone if you like the early Wizardry games this one is a love letter to the dungeon crawling days of yore.

Clumsy and Disappointing

Not even as interesting as Wizardry 1 or 2, this new Japanese edition is certainly not geared for old-time fans like me. The interface is highly limited and clunky, there is no tutorial or manual anywhere, and one has to guess which keys move you where, and that's just the sad beginning. Creating characters isn't as reasonable as once was either, and no direction and/or advice is offered anywhere. I am a huge fan of Wizardry, as having played them all; maybe that's why this is such a dreadful disappointment. Pass.

It's ok

The game is ok, I guess? their is no tutorial to speak of and the game essentially tells you nothing, right from the get go you pick a character you want to play and get a random amount of points to place in your stats like any basic RPG, BUT each class has min stat requirements that the game does not tell you so you have to play a guessing game on your stats to pick a class, moreover their are classes that are alliangment bound and their are classes that you can never even get unless you get really lucky with the random stat generator, or use your 1TIME DLC FRUIT that you can NEVER GET BACK, even if you start a "new game", also the quest requirements are all random drops so the 1st quest can take you 5min or 25min to complete, depending on if you have someone who can appraise the item like a bishop or GRIND pitiful amounts of money from mobs to pay for appraisal. Leveling up is a crapshoot since you don't choose where your stats go which would be fine but apparently you can LOSE stats on lvl ups? why? so i can get punished for leveling up in an RPG for doing nothing more than playing the game. lastly this game has REALLY BAD directions, some quest givers will send you out to get something that you'll have to grind for but then also say "it's in the mid levels of the dungeon" Bruh that's 2-3 FLOORS you have to FULLY MAP unless you get lucky and go the right direction the first time. This game is good for a couple of hours and at a discounted price it's not bad but anything above $10 is a really hard sell, this game gets very repetitive and pretty much plays its' self, if you can get past the crushing difficult beginning lvls 1-3 the game becomes insanely easy after since their is pretty much no weapon veriety, it'll be the same weps and armor with just a +1or2 tacked on to the end.

Solid and good Wizardry Entry

Many Wizardry fans probably know that Wizardry, since it exists, took a lot of different roots and experiments. The last experiment, Wizardry 8, pretty much killed the franchise... almost. While the west gave up on Wizardry after the debacle that was 8, the Japanese went back from these experiments and focused on the earlier titles that where most liked by the fans. And this is the result. From the visuals, there is no doubt that this is from a Japanese developer, but other then the looks, this is good old Wizardry. Like "The Five Ordeals" this is back to the roots and yes, some people don't like oldshool dungeon crawler so if you don't... you should not buy one. It is not 100% oldshool though. Obviously the graphics are 3D (except the sprites which are 2D which i personally prefer), but it does come with some improvements/quality of life features other modern Dungeon Crawler have too. For example, outside of the Dungeon, you no longer have to walk around the town but can just directly select where you want to go (Basically like in TRPG). It seems like some people dislike that but the game is already very long, that is a good improvement to save you wasting time and, as said, all modern dungeon crawler do this, for a good reason. Also most of the stuff is explained inside the game, you do not have to read a 100 page manual to be able to play the game. So its not 100% authentic but lets be honest, that would be unrealistic to expect. But imho these are rather minor changes, the overall tone and look&feel that made Wizardry famous to begin with is there, just transported in the modern age. Overall it is weaker than "The Five Ordeals", there are no DLC (there is one, but no new), there is no tool to create your own adventures and so on. Its a port of an PS3 game, nothing more, nothing less. If you want more, you have to get Five Ordeals which comes in at a higher price too.
